Burien is definitely an up and coming location; its "old town" is full of trendy cafes and hip bars - really a nice area. For a visitor wanting to experience Seattle, however, I'd probably find it a bit inconvenient; you'd be spending a lot of time on buses or the light rail, or if you have a car (which might be sensible in an Airbnb situation) you'd be fighting a lot of traffic. As far as crime goes, it's not especially a hot spot, but as with all urban areas one needs to exercise caution if you're out late at night on foot, etc. Certainly I wouldn't let fear of crime be a deterrent from staying in Burien.
